This refactoring CL does the following: - moves all the dart code for isolates in a common library (lib/isolate) - changes frog to understand 'dart:isolate' imoprts by loading the code from the location above. - changes the vm to undernstand 'dart:isolate' imports by creating a separate library that is part of the bootstrap. This follows the same code-structure that Todd suggested in his CL introducing the mirror library - changes dartc to use the shared isolate library as the source of truth for type checking. I left around some of the internal js code in dartc so that the backend continues to work for apps that don't use isolates. - changes all tests that use isolates to import the library explicitly (this is a large bulk of the files in this CL) - changes test status for tests we can't fix in this repo (e.g. co19) - splits the isolate library code to make it possible to preserve some tests without exposing internal types (e.g. tests about serialization/deserialization) - changes the create_sdk script to copy the isolate library to the sdk - includes the isolate library in dartdoc I'll wait for at least one lgtm from each area (dartc, vm, frog, sdk) There is one important pending thing this CL doesn't do: - update test_runner.dart: This should be updated next time we upload the new binaries to tool/testing/bin - dartium specific changes: Vijay, is there anything I need to do for dartium?
